HILO was delisted on the 14th of June, 2019.
15 hedge funds and large institutions have $6.22M invested in Columbia EM Quality Dividend ETF in 2016 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 2 funds opening new positions, 4 increasing their positions, 6 reducing their positions, and 1 closing their positions.
